Adjusting the child seat
4.1 Adjusting the shoulder straps and
headrest
Correctly adjusted shoulder straps ensure optimal
protection for your child in the safety seat.
For child weight 0-13kg - Rear facing
The shoulder straps are at the same level but
not lower than your child's shoulders.
For child weight 9-18kg - Foward facing
The shoulder straps are at the same level or
higher than your child's shoulders.
To adjust the height of the shoulder straps and
headrest to fit your child:
• Press and hold the Central Adjuster button,
while pulling both of the shoulder straps as
far forward as possible (4-A).
• Release the child seat buckle by pressing the
red button, then split the buckle tongues on
each side of the seat (4-B).
• Lift up the headrest button and move up/
down the headrest (4-C) to make sure the
harness belt strap slots are level with or just
above your child's shoulders (4-D).
